India is up against Syria in their last group stage match of the ongoing AFC Asian Cup today at Al Bayt Stadium in Al Khor, Qatar. A 0-2 and 0-3 defeat to Australia and Uzbekistan laid bare India's inability to give strong competition to the top teams of the continent but a win against Syria can salvage some pride for the Sunil Chhetri-led side.
Syria are currently ranked at 91st in the FIFA chart, 11 places above India but a victory is not impossible for the Igor Stimac-coached side as they had won in the past -- in 2007, 2009 and 2012 Nehru Cup tournaments.
